Key YouTube Metrics for Campaign Success
Before diving into AI tools, it’s crucial to understand which metrics truly matter for evaluating your YouTube campaigns. These metrics provide insights into audience engagement, content performance, and overall return on investment.
1. View Count
The total number of views indicates how many times your video has been watched. While a high view count suggests popularity, it doesn't necessarily equate to engagement or conversions. AI tools can analyze view patterns to identify peak engagement times and viewer retention trends.
2. Watch Time
Watch time measures the total amount of time viewers spend watching your videos. This metric is critical for YouTube’s algorithm and can be optimized using AI-driven insights to enhance content that retains viewers longer.
3. Audience Retention
Audience retention shows the percentage of viewers who watch your video from start to finish. High retention indicates engaging content, while drops may highlight parts needing improvement. AI tools can pinpoint exactly where viewers lose interest.
4. Click-Through Rate (CTR)
CTR measures how often viewers click on your video after seeing the thumbnail. A high CTR suggests compelling thumbnails and titles. AI can analyze thumbnail performance and suggest improvements to increase clicks.
AI Tools Enhancing Campaign Measurement
Artificial intelligence is transforming how marketers interpret YouTube metrics. Here are some AI-powered tools making a difference:
- TubeBuddy: Offers AI-driven insights for optimizing video titles, tags, and thumbnails based on performance data.
- VidIQ: Provides real-time analytics and AI recommendations to improve engagement and reach.
- Brandwatch: Uses AI to analyze audience sentiment and identify trending topics relevant to your content.
- Hootsuite Insights: Employs AI to monitor social media conversations and measure campaign impact across platforms.
